Front Lower Arm Bushing





Front Lower Arm Bushing

Special Service Tools






Remover/installer

204-507

Removal

NOTE:
bushes must be replaced as a pair
1 Raise and support the vehicle.
2 Remove the wheels and tires.




3 LH front: Release the suspension height sensor link.
4 Release the LH front lower arm.
- Remove and discard the bolt.




5 Using the special tools, remove the front lower arm bushes.

Installation





1 Using the special tools, install the front lower arm bushes.
2
WARNING: Make sure that a new bolt is installed.
CAUTION: Only tighten the nuts and bolts when the suspension is in the normal drive position.
Secure the LH front lower arm.
- Tighten the nut and bolt to 165 Nm (121 lb.ft). plus a further 90 degrees.
3 LH front: Secure the suspension height sensor link.
4 Repeat the above procedure for the RH side.
5 Install the wheels and tires.
- Tighten the wheel nuts to 140 Nm (103 lb.ft).
6 Check, and if necessary, adjust the wheel alignment.
